Subject: Marketing Budget Reduction — Q4

To the finance team: as discussed with the executive group at Verlane Goods, the Q4 marketing budget will be reduced by eighteen percent. The cut applies to paid campaigns only; the Thornby trade event commitment stands. Please reforecast by Friday and flag any contractual penalties. Agency retainers are under separate review. The broader rationale tied to next year's plan follows below.

board note of yajeg-yaweg: The pricing group signed off on a budget of $4.9 million for Project Quenix. The renewal with Sormirek Freight closes at $6.1 million a year, 37 percent below the last contract.

# Break-Glass: Catalog Cache Invalidation

Scope: the Pinrow product catalog at Veldstone Retail. If stale prices persist after a purge and the Hollowmere invalidation queue is wedged, use break-glass to flush the edge tier directly. Contractors: get verbal sign-off from the catalog lead first. Steps: open the Hollowmere admin shell, select emergency-flush, confirm the tenant, and run it once — repeated flushes thrash the origin. Access is logged and expires after 20 minutes. Unseal the admin shell with the passphrase below.

recovery phrase for kahop-tajog: istix-casvan

## Releases

Welcome aboard! Quieten, our on-call alert deduplicator, ships every other Thursday. We cut a tag from main, run the smoke suite against the Farwick staging cluster, and push artifacts to the internal registry. If you're doing the release, ping whoever's on rotation first — usually Marla or Deet — so nobody double-cuts. Hotfixes skip the schedule but still need a signed build; unsigned tarballs get rejected at deploy time, no exceptions. To verify any release artifact locally, use the current signing key below.

signing key of yagug-bawif = bky9_cvCf6ehGp

**Mgmt Meeting Minutes — Retiring the Brightline Range**

Quick recap for sales leads at Fenholt Supplies: we agreed to retire the Brightline fixture range by year-end. Remaining stock moves to clearance pricing next month, and accounts on standing orders get migrated to the Lumetta range. Trade-in incentives were approved in principle. The confidential note on next steps sits just below.

board note of bajof-bajeg: The pricing group signed off on a budget of $13.4 million for Project Sildor. The renewal with Lamixek Holdings closes at $48.9 million a year, 49 percent above the last contract.